Cockatoo Wikipedia ~ A cockatoo is any of the 21 parrot species belonging to the family Cacatuidae the only family in the superfamily with the Psittacoidea true parrots and the Strigopoidea large New Zealand parrots they make up the order family has a mainly Australasian distribution ranging from the Philippines and the eastern Indonesian islands of Wallacea to New
Sulphurcrested cockatoo Wikipedia ~ The sulphurcrested cockatoo Cacatua galerita is a relatively large white cockatoo found in wooded habitats in Australia and New Guinea and some of the islands of Indonesia They can be locally very numerous leading to them sometimes being considered pestsA highly intelligent bird they are well known in aviculture although they can be demanding pets
Cockatoos Available for Adoption Rescue the Birds ~ Cockatoos share many features with other parrots like the characteristic curved beak shape and a zygodactyl foot but differ with the often spectacular movable headcrest the presence of a gall bladder and some other anatomical details
